SAPS Walmer Park detectives opened an inquest after the body of an unknown man was found at Sardinia Bay Beach this morning, July 17.
According to police spokesperson, Captain Sandra Janse van Rensburg, it is alleged that at approximately 08:15 SAPS was alerted to the body of an unknown African male that was washed out of the sea at Sardina Bay Beach.
She explained that community members, SAPS divers, and K9 search and rescue assisted in retrieving the body.
She said the man is dressed in a diving suit and is estimated to be in his thirties.
“He had an open wound to the back of his head; however, the cause of death will only be determined once a postmortem is done,” she revealed.
